Applications of Piston Fillers in Various Industries
Piston fillers are essential tools across various industries. They allow for precise and consistent filling of liquids, pastes, and creams. Their versatility makes them suitable for food and beverage, cosmetics, and pharmaceutical sectors. In food production, piston fillers ensure that sauces and dressings are dispensed accurately. This precision minimizes waste and enhances the quality of final products.
In the cosmetics industry, these machines can handle thicker consistencies, like lotions. Operators need to consider the viscosity of the product. Not all fillers perform equally across different textures. This highlights the importance of selecting the right equipment. The right piston filler not only meets production needs but also maintains product integrity.
Piston fillers also find applications in pharmaceuticals. They are crucial for filling syringes and vials with liquid medications. Here, accuracy is paramount. Any deviation can lead to serious consequences. Many manufacturers struggle with calibration and maintenance. Regular checks are essential to ensure reliability and compliance. Maintenance and Troubleshooting Tips for Piston Fillers
When using piston fillers, maintenance is key. Regular upkeep ensures optimal performance and prolongs the lifespan of your equipment. Industry data shows that improper maintenance can lead to a 25% decrease in efficiency. This directly impacts productivity and costs. Operators should conduct weekly inspections, checking seals and nozzles for wear and tear. Any signs of leakage may indicate the need for immediate replacement.
Troubleshooting common issues is essential. For example, inconsistent fill levels can stem from air bubbles or faulty sensors. Reports suggest that 15% of filler issues arise from air entrapment in the system. Addressing this involves purging air from the lines. Additionally, regular calibration of the fillers can prevent discrepancies in measurements. Operators often overlook this critical step, which can lead to unnecessary waste.
